Inventory of William Murphy

Franklin County
July Term AD 1860
Pages 223-225
An inventory of the personal estate of William Murphy deceased taken by James Murphy Administrator and appraised by Lewis Whiteman & Smith Dubois.

No. Description of Property Valuation
1 6 cane bottom chairs 4.00x
2 2 winsor chairs 1.20x
3 3 split bottom chairs .75x
4 1 safe 5.50x
5 1 Breakfast tabel 2.25x
6 1 dining tabel 3.00
7 1 stand .25
8 1 beurough 9.00x
9 1 corner cubbord 2.00x
10 1 lot of cubbord ware 3.25x
11 1 set of knives & forks & cubbord 1.00x

12 1 cooking stove 8.00x
13 3 flat irons .33x
14 1 lot old irons .50
15 1 copper kettel 1.00x
16 1 tub & wash board .60x
17 1 bed & bedding 12.00x
18 1 bed & bedding 25.00x
19 1 bed & bedding 8.00
20 1 bed & bedding 15.00x
21 2 trunks 1.00x
22 1 lot of carpet 5.00x
23 1 lot of nails 1.50
24 1 lot of barrels .15x
25 1 hand sive .15x
carried forward $109.93
26 1 lot of jugs .35x
27 1 lot of glas .50x
28 1 churn 2.20x
29 1 lot of crockery ware .75x
30 2 sider barls 1.00x
31 1 iron kettel 2.00x
32 2 axes & mall 1.50
33 1 hand saw & spaid 1.50
34 1 lot oof pork tubs 2.00x
35 1 lot of lumber 4.00
36 1 drawing knife .25
37 1 two horse sley & 2 hoes 5.50
38 1 log sledds .50
39 1 lot of sacks 1.25x
40 7 bushels of barley 3.50
41 1 wind mill 18.00
42 2 scope shovels .50
43 1 man sadel 2.00
44 2 hay forks .75
45 2 half bushels .75
46 1 basket .25x
47 1 cuting box 9.00
48 1 set of geers 8.00
49 1 sod plow 6.00
50 2 dubl shovel plows 6.00
51 1 pair of stay chains .50
carried forward $78.85
52 1 log chain 1.00
53 Two horse plow & doubletree 7.00
54 1 two horse wagon 75.00

55 1 lot of Fall barley 13.00
56 1 lot of Spring barley 40.00
57 1 lot of hay .50
58 1 lot of wheat 30 bushels 18.00x
59 1 lot of wheat 24.00
60 1 peck & half peck .25
61 1 plow & hoedig 5.00
62 1 black mair 75.00
63 1 grey mair 80.00
64 1 bay mair 25.00
65 2 spring colts 50.00
66 1 white faced cow 18.00x
67 1 spoted faced cow 15.00
68 1 brindel cow 14.00x
69 1 white calf 10.00x
70 1 red calf 5.00
71 1 spoted calf 5.00
72 1 specaed fored calf 6.00
73 1 bull calf 5.60
74 72 hogs 633.60
75 80 acres of corn 96.00x
carried forward $1221.95
76 2 achors of corn 24.00
77 1 half of 14 achors of wheat growing in the ground to be put in shock 35.00
78 15 achors of wheat & folow ground 60.00
79 4½ achors cover ground 13.50
80 5 achors of barley 15.00
81 2 doz barley 8.00
82 5 hogs 46.75x
83 1 foot adz 1.00
84 7 achors 6 grads? 66.00
85 14 head of shots 34.00
86 1 dubel tree .48
87 1 jockey stict .38
89 3 of corn 1.35
90 6 1/3 bushel corn 3.29
91 1 lot of hay 1.50
Total $1721.98

Signed by us the 22day of November 1858
Lewis Whitemore
Smith Dubois, appraisers

x = widow's selection [$309.03]
